What are Studded Tubes: Features, Uses & Industrial Applications

A studded tube can easily replace Finned tubes for heat transfer. They generally require regular or frequent cleaning and must be resistant to aggressive materials. Some boiler and furnace surfaces are prone to corrosion. Using studded tubes in such cases is extremely beneficial.

studded tubes

What is a Studded Tube?

 
Studded tubes are a type of metal tubes. These tubes have studs welded onto the metal tube. These studs are arranged in a specific formation throughout the length of the tube. They are often used in boilers and refineries. As they increase the surface area for higher heat transfer they are used for reheating.

Making of a Studded Tube

 
When an electric current is passed at the contact point of the studs and the tube, this, in turn, provides resistance. The resistance causes heat to be produced which is then used for welding. Maximum heat is generated at the interface of the tube and the studs due to maximum resistance. No external heat source is used to weld the studs and tubes together. The pressure is used to forge the two together instead. Hence, they are extremely useful in the process that works under high temperature and pressure.

Uses and Applications of Studded Tubes

 
Studded Tubes are mostly used in boilers and furnaces. Mostly in a corrosive environment. In petrochemical industries, high crude oil which has high density is passed through studded tubes. Heat is generated from outside the tube. On the other end of the tube, we obtain a liquid product which is later sent for processing.

Studded tubes are also used in water tube boilers. They help in heating water. The studded tubes are oval shaped and are welded onto the boilers.

The amount of bare pipes used is reduced by the usage of studded tubes as heat transfer surface of one studded tube can replace the surface of 4 to 10 bare pipes.

Studded tubes can be used in applications where harsh fuels are used which can cause damage to the environment. To protect them from corrosion, the external surfaces of the studded tubes can be coated or treated with a protective layer.

Since studded tubes minimize erosion, they are also used in Soda ash boilers and fluidized bed reactors.

They are also used in steel plants, air coolers, power plants, heat exchangers, etc.
